Hi,

little update from us:

  • we could finally restore AUv3 compatibility on devices running iOS 14+, it was one line of code and days of work :slight_smile:
  • samplerate/buffersize behaviour has been improved
  • the audio device on mac is in the making (it will already be installed and detected within the new server for testing, but not receive or send audio)
  • vsts are now installed via shell script (sudo) only, you may have to remove the old ones before installing the server
